We're drinking more to cope with lockdown, survey finds

More than half of Irish adults are now drinking every week, with 25% drinking more during the Covid-19 crisis, a new study has found.

A large majority (88%) said that they drank at this time 'to help relax and unwind’ as almost half (47%) of survey respondents said that tensions in their household had increased in the past 30 days.
